The 2008 presidential candidate of the CPP, Dr. Papa Kwesi Nduom, commissioned eight party offices in the Ashanti Region at the weekend. The party offices, which were solely funded by Dr. Nduom, are part of his efforts to resuscitate the CPP from the grassroots through polling station organisation.
